Alexander McQueen Iris Plexiglas Box Clutch, Handbag of the Day
McQueen Iris Plexiglass Clutch
The Alexander McQueen Iris Plexiglas Box Clutch is one of those statement pieces that's sure to garner glances and comments and envy whenever and wherever you carry it. The construction is pretty simple considering its impact: molded plexigas topped with a Swarovski-embellished gold metal clasp depicting a skull sitting inside a fully opened iris bloom. Very gothic-chic (as the brand does so well) but with a decidedly lighter vibe this time. Features are basic but include a gold metal frame and inside there's white leather trim. $2,295

Anya Hindmarch Marano Glitter-Finish Clutch, Handbag of the Day
Anya HIndmarch Glitter Clutch
Add a bit of princess-like pink sparkle to your evenings out with this Marano Glitter-Finish Leather Clutch by Anya Hindmarch. Easily paired with neutral, gray, white, or black this clutch could be the timeless investment piece that always makes you feel uber feminine and gorgeous, without going overboard into gaudy territory. Glitter-sprayed leather on a gold frame features a designer-stamped push clasp fastener on top and an interior lined in light suede with a single, pink-trimmed pouch pocket. Heads up there's no shoulder strap, detachable or otherwise. $550

Breguet Marine Tourbillon Ref. 5839 High Jewellery Chronograph Watch

In the watch world diamonds seem to make just about everything better. This Ref. 5839 Marine Troubillon High Jewellery watch is a diamond encrusted version of the Ref. 5937 from a few years ago. Breguet outfitted the watch case and dial with an impressive amount of diamonds, but still was able to retain that signature Breguet Marine watch look.

The 43mm wide 18k white gold case as about 11.77 carats of stones on it. One of the neatest parts is how Breguet was able to maintain the coined edge of the case using specially cut diamonds. Also not the unique pattern the diamonds create for the bezel. On the dial smaller diamonds are set in the middle of the dial and don't overshadow the hands. The dial itself is silvered 18k gold. Overall Breguet did a great job giving a men's jewelry watch a functional face.

Inside the watch is a Breguet caliber 554.4 manually wound tourbillon movement with the time and a chronograph complication. The watch has 50 hours of power reserve with special features that include a silicium balance spring and escapement wheel.

Milly Snake-Effect Leather Shoulder Bag, Handbag of the Day
Milly Snake-effect leather shoulder bag
The subtle sheen on this Snake-Effect Leather Shoulder Bag by Milly gives the casual bucket-bag styling a nice "resort glam" upgrade, with just a hint of bohemian energy. Features on this shimmery cutie include a single bamboo top handle (a bit of matte earthy contrast) plus a detachable textured-leather shoulder strap, drawstring closure with bamboo-embellished leather tassels, goldtone hardware, protective feet, and a designer-stamped hanging charm. Inside it's lined in olive green twill (again with the earthiness) and has several pockets. A great summer essential that will go with practically everything. $475

Napoleon Entering Cairo Statue Available At Rau Antiques

There is an almost eerie quality to this one of a kind custom made statue depicting Napoleon Bonaparte as he enters Cario during his campaign in Egypt. The small statue was made by famed French artist Jean-Léon Gérôme as a smaller version of a larger bronze statue. It was made around 1897. The statue is done in an ancient style known as "chryselephantine." The inner part of the statue is wood, while it is overlaid with gold and ivory. Ivory is used for Napoleon's face to simulate a more realistic flesh like look. The statue is about 16 and a half inches high.

Gerome, the artist, favored such older Roman and Greek sculpting techniques. The original bronze statue was bought by the French government for public display. This work is an amazing historical reference as well as example of neo-classic revival in the 19th century that has since never been better. Price is $198,000 at Rau Antiques. Learn more here.

Girard-Perregaux Cat's Eye Tourbillon Haute Joaillerie Watch

For half a million dollars you can get a lot of watches or this lovely new high jewelry watch from Swiss Girard-Perregaux. The Cat's Eye Tourbillon Haute Joaillerie timepiece has an 18k white gold case and is 32mm wide by 38mm tall in the typical Cat's Eye oval shape. It has a stunning amount of large diamonds all over it. According to Girard-Perregaux the watch required over 700 hours of work to create, containing over 20 carats of diamonds. The precious stones come in various cuts and are placed all over the case, crown, and dial.

Inside the watch is a Girard-Perregaux in-house made caliber GP09700-0006 manually wound tourbillon movement. The Tourbillon escapement is visible on the dial using a traditional GP style bridge. The movement has a power reserve of about three days. Attached to the strap is a gray satin strap with a white gold buckle... and more diamonds. Price for this very impressive haute joaillerie watch is $490,000.
